Not sure if this has already been considered, but after a certain number of levels in Vaagur/levels in skill ancients, the skill's duration is equal to or greater than its cooldown. Would be cool if the calculator took this into account and stopped putting levels into the respective skill ancient once that threshold is reached!

At least for the beginning levels of Morgulis the Ancient of Death the cost to level him alternates between 1HS and 2HS. i.e. level one costs 1HS, level 2 is 2HS, level 3 is 1HS. I dont know if this levels out to 1HS 100% of the time after so many levels but because the beginning cost to level this ancient alternates and the calculator always assumes every level costs 1HS this causes the calculator to recommend you level him more than you have the HS to.
